Minnesota McDaniels fractures right hand in wall slam
Minnesota Timberwolves forward Jayden McDaniels (23) was injured in the rage of the moment.
The Timberwolves club updated McDaniels’ injury situation on the club’s official website on the 11th (Korean time).
According to this, following the X-ray examination, McDaniels underwent further examination by Dr. Kelechi Okoroha at Mayo Clinic Square and was diagnosed with a fracture of the 3rd and 4th metacarpal bones.
First, I put a cast on my right hand. An expected return time has not yet been released. They said they would monitor the road and update further information when possible.
McDaniels suffered an injury after punching the wall in a fit of rage while entering the locker room during a game against the New Orleans Pelicans the previous day.
After being named by the Los Angeles Lakers with the 28th overall pick in the first round of the November 2020 draft, he transferred to Minnesota through a direct trade. He averaged 9.6 points, 3.9 rebounds and 1.4 assists in 212 games over the past three seasons.
